The Indian sage Ramana Maharshi (1879-1950) is perhaps the most widely known Indian spiritual figure of the last century, second only to Gandhi. This new book offers a fresh introduction to the Maharshi's life and teachings, intending to situate him within the non-dualistic traditions of
Hinduism. It also delves into themes and questions particularly relevant to the spiritual crisis and search for meaning that have characterized, in various ways, both the modern and postmodern outlooks.
